What is Mesothelioma?
Mesothelioma is a malignant cancer affecting the mesothelium, the protective lining that covers the internal organs. It is most typically related to asbestos exposure. Kinds of mesothelioma consist of:

Consulting with an attorney experienced in this field is vital to browsing legal obstacles efficiently. Q3: What are the typical treatment choices for mesothelioma? A3: Treatment alternatives might include surgery, ch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and newer immunotherapies. The treatment plan depends on the client's health, age, and stage of cancer.
